Col6a1促进三阴性乳腺癌细胞耐药性及干性  

Col6a1 boosts triple-negative breast cancer cell drug resistance and stemness

摘  要:目的:分析VI型胶原蛋白α1(collagen type VIalpha 1,Col6a1)在三阴性乳腺癌中的表达及其对三阴性乳腺癌细胞耐药性和干性的影响。方法:采用生物信息学方法分析Col6a1对三阴性乳腺癌患者预后的影响及在三阴性乳腺癌细胞中的表达以及与耐药相关蛋白ATP结合盒(ABC)超家族G成员2[TP-binding cassette(ABC)superfamily G member 2,ABCG2]的关系;采用免疫组化检测Col6a1在三阴性和非三阴性乳腺癌组织中的表达;采用MTT法检测Col6a1对三阴性乳腺癌细胞耐药性的影响;采用乳腺癌成球实验,检测Col6a1对三阴性乳腺癌细胞干性的影响。结果:Col6a1在三阴性乳腺癌患者中高表达,并与不良预后有关;Col6a1在三阴性乳腺癌组织及细胞系中过表达;Col6a1与ABCG2表达成正相关;Col6a1敲减后,三阴性乳腺癌细胞MDA-MB-231及Hs 578T对紫杉醇更敏感,并且会使这两种细胞的成球率降低。结论:Col6a1促进三阴性乳腺癌细胞耐药性及干性;Col6a1可作为三阴性乳腺癌治疗的一个潜在靶点。Objective:To analyze the expression of collagen type VI alpha 1(Col6a1)in triple-negative breast cancer and its effect on drug resistance and stemness of triple-negative breast cancer cells.Methods:Bioinformatics method analyzed the effect of Col6a1 on the prognosis in triple-negative breast cancer,the expression of Col6a1 in triple-negative breast cancer cells and the relationship with the drug resistance-related protein ATP-binding cassette(ABC)superfamily G member 2(ABCG2).Immunohistochemistry was used to detect the Col6a1 expression in triple-negative breast cancer tissues and non-triple-negative breast cancer tissues.The effect of Col6a1 on drug resistance in triple-negative breast cancer cells was examined by MTT assay.Mammosphere formation test was then used to evaluate the role of Col6a1 in triple-negative breast cell stemness.Results:Col6a1 was overexpressed in triple-negative breast cancer and was correlated with unfavorable prognosis.Col6a1 was overexpressed in triple-negative breast cancer tissues and cells.Col6a1 was positively correlated with ABCG2.Col6a1 knockdown enhanced the sensitivity of MDA-MB-231 cells and Hs 578T cells to paclitaxel(PTX)and impaired mammosphere formation capacity of these two cell lines.Conclusion:Col6a1 contributes to triple-negative breast cancer cells drug resistance and stemness,and can be a potential target for the treatment of triple-negative breast cancer.
